Live Enterprise Suite is a dreadful fake anti-virus program developed solely for the purpose of gaining revenue from this fraudulent activity. With Live Enterprise Suite’s capability to install itself on computer via Trojan, users may be blinded by its fake warnings and alerts messages. User sees a variety of warning alerts and messages that will be so irritating. Thinking that it was coming from legitimate Windows alert, people can easily persuade to proceed to payment processing web site and obtain the licensed version. Keep in mind that even with registered version of Live Enterprise Suite; you will still see the same annoyances on computer. It’s too late that you may realized that the transactions were counterfeit.
You must know that Live Enterprise Suite and other malware of the same kind arrive on the PC through various security weaknesses. Thus, to prevent infection, you must download and install latest updates for all programs running on the computer. If in case, the PC is already infected with Live Enterprise Suite, do not buy this rogue program. It will not help in resolving the current issue. What are the Symptoms of Live Enterprise Suite Infection?
A computer scan will be launched by Live Enterprise Suite and display fake reports to mislead computer users.
It will modify Windows Registry and add the following entries:
- H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run “Live Enterprise Suite”
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\Current Version\Uninstall\567 1.4.2.0_is1
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\Current Version\Uninstall\Live Enterprise Suite_is1
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\Current Version\Image File Execution Options\taskmgr.exe
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\ControlSet001\Enum\Root\LEGACY_HTGRDENGINE
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\ControlSet001\Services\HTGrdEngine
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Enum\Root\LEGACY_HTGRDENGINE
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Services\HTGrdEngine
- H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run “Microsoft Windows logon process”
-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main\FeatureControl\FEATURE_BROWSER_EMULATION “svchost.exe”
The threat will drop the following malicious files:
- %Program Files%\Common Files\char.exe
- %Program Files%\Common Files\calc.exe
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\settings.ini
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\uill.ini
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\unins000.exe
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\updateloadlist.ini
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\db
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\db\config.cfg
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\db\Timeout.inf
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Live Enterprise Suite\db\Urls.inf
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Application Data\Microsoft\Windows\winlogon.exe
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Local Settings\Application Data\Microsoft\Windows\log.txt
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Local Settings\Application Data\Microsoft\Windows\pguard.ini
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\Local Settings\Application Data\Microsoft\Windows\services.exe
- %Documents and Settings%\[UserName]\My Documents\My Pictures\atbyin.exe
How to Remove Live Enterprise Suite Manually
1. Restart your computer in SafeMode
– After Power-On the computer, just before Windows start, press F8
– From the selections, Select SafeMode
2. Remove Registry entries that the threat added. You MUST BACKUP YOUR REGISTRY FIRST.
– Click Start > Run
– Type in the field, regedit
– Navigate and look for the registry entries mentioned above and delete if necessary
3. Delete malicious files that the threat added:
– Base on the given location above, browse and delete the file
– If no location is given, click Start>Search> and search for the files.
– If cannot be deleted, press Ctrl+Alt+Del to access Task Manager, see if the file is running in the process. If it is, select the file and click End Process. Perform file delete again.
4. Scan computer with Antivirus Program
– Update antivirus program
– Scan computer and delete all detected threats.
